1. Speed-Torque Characteristics and Armature Reaction

The fundamental electromagnetic benefit of a shunt wound DC motor is derived from the separation of the armature and excitation circuits. The torque is proportional to the product of armature current ($I_a$) and field flux ($\Phi$). Because the field winding is connected directly across the supply line, the excitation current ($I_f$) is practically constant, producing a stable field flux.

When load is applied to the output shaft, the speed experiences an extremely low dip—only about 5% to 10% from zero-load to full-load. This minor drop occurs solely due to the armature resistance voltage drop ($I_a R_a$) and armature reaction. Under conditions of severe workload shifts, this constant-speed attribute protects sensitive downstream mechanical linkages from failure.

2. Moscow Industrial Demands: Cold Climate Engineering & Protection

Industrial facilities situated in the Russian Federation demand special engineering protections due to sub-zero winters. When standard motors operate in cold conditions, default grease thickens, bearing friction increases, and brushes suffer from excessive sparking.

Sweg Motor addresses these challenges through the deployment of low-temperature synthetic lubrication and specialized vacuum-impregnated H-Class insulation windings. Furthermore, our IP54 enclosures prevent airborne dust, freezing drizzle, and melting snow from penetrating the stator frame, safeguarding continuous operations in municipal transit and processing facilities.

Motor Type Speed Characteristic Starting Torque Optimal Applications
Shunt Wound Constant (Self-Regulated) Medium-High Conveyors, Machine Tools, Industrial Centrifuges
Series Wound Variable (Inversely Proportional to Load) Extremely High Electric Locomotives, Heavy Cranes, Starter Motors
Compound Wound Semi-Variable High Heavy Punch Presses, Elevators, High-Impact Drills

How does a shunt wound DC motor maintain constant speed?

Because the field winding is connected in parallel with the armature across the supply, field current (and thus magnetic flux) is constant under steady terminal voltage. As mechanical load changes, the armature current adjusts naturally with minimal effect on flux, keeping speed extremely stable.
